Ray Wadsworth, a longtime figure in Alaska fisheries, is turning 80 in 2026, but age isn’t slowing him down much, if at all. Wadsworth has brought a few innovations to the fishing industry, such as his pin bone machine. “In the early 2000s I spent 6.6 million dollars inventing a machine that would fillet a salmon and remove all the bones, including the pin bones, but with a fresh fish that hadn’t gone into rigor mortis yet.” 

Wadsworth took the machine to Chignik down on the Alaska Peninsula and got it set up to process live fish. “I had a floating processor called the New West, and we had live pens alongside for the fish,” he explains. “We had a few boats with oxygenators in their holds to keep the fish alive, and they’d put the fish in our pens. Then we’d take them out of the water, bleed them, run them through the machine, vacuum pack them, and freeze them before they ever went into rigor mortis. This was the freshest fish in the world, but the processors were still canning, so it never caught on. I lost everything.” 

But Ray Wadsworth is one of those people who doesn’t quit, one of those people who can lose everything and then get back on top again. “I went back to what I do best,” he says. “Designing and building boats and catching fish.” Since then, Wadsworth has built and sold several boats now operating in the salmon fishery, mostly tenders and seiners, and he is still inventing. His latest creation is an amphibious skiff that he initially thought could be useful in the set net fishery. “It’s 30 feet by 10 feet,” says Wadsworth. “And it has tracks that fold down so it can crawl up the beach about as fast as you can walk.” 

After building the boat at his shop in Oakley, Idaho, Wadsworth trailered it up to Alaska and took it across to Seldovia, on Kachemak Bay. “We slept in it on the way up,” he says. “It’s got bunks and a little galley.”

Wadsworth’s latest invention is an amphibious skiff designed for set netters, hunters, and anyone who has to work with big tides that can leave skiffs sitting on the intertidal sand flats for hours. Photo courtesy of Ray Wadsworth

Powered by a Cummins 8.9-liter engine driving a Chinese-built AWT JT342 jet, Wadsworth reports getting the boat up to 30 knots. “It only draws a foot,” he says. 

When the boat approaches the beach, Wadsworth lowers the tracks from the sides and engages the hydraulic motor that drives them. “It was a lot harder to build than I had imagined,” he says. “The tracks are a rubber material like snowmobile tracks, and getting the rams and drives for them figured out took a long time. It’s got a ramp in the front that goes down, and that took some engineering.”

According to Wadsworth, he wanted a sharp bow like a regular boat, but getting the ramp to work with that proved to be more of a challenge than he bargained for. “I have all the CAD drawings for it. If somebody wanted one, I would build it with a flat bow, not as pretty but a lot easier.” 

For now, Wadsworth’s latest invention, the amphibious skiff that he designed like set netters, is sitting on his land in Seldovia. “I don’t know if there’s any interest,” he says. “It could also be good for anyone who has to deal with big tides.”
